He then commented that under no circumstance would the City allow a house <br />closer than 50 feet to the lake. <br /> <br />Commissioner McLean asked Ms. Moore-Sykes to search the document to make sure that <br />the setback issue with regard to properties on a lake is not addressed in any other location <br />in the Ordinance. <br /> <br />Acting Chair DeVine indicated that the new requirement for site plan review gives staff <br />time to review the project and provide comments in the staff report before it comes to the <br />Planning Commission. <br /> <br />Commissioner McLean suggested deleting the language on Page 31 concerning permitted <br />principal uses. The Commission determined that the two sentences he was referring to on <br />Page 31 should be deleted and the words permitted uses and/or uses permitted by special <br />use permit should be used. <br /> <br />Motion bv Commission Member McLean. seconded by Commission Member <br />Wilharber to accept the fourth addition amendments to Ordinance #4 with the <br />noted chan\:es. recommend to Council approval of Ordinance #4 as amended, and <br />ask that Council hold the public hearing in order to speed the \lrocess alon!!. <br /> <br />Commissioner Wilharber suggested a friendly amendment to request that the public <br />hearing be held at the Council level in order to speed up the process. <br /> <br />Vote: All in favor. Motion carried unanimouslv. <br /> <br />2. Zoninl?: Map Modifications <br /> <br />Ms. Moore-Sykes indicated she had attended the Tri-City meeting with Hugo and Lino <br />Lakes and there was some discussion concerning extending the trails from the Hugo side <br />ofthe freeway. She then questioned whether it would be possible to connect the trails to <br />the C-l zoned area. <br /> <br />Commissioner Wilharber indicatcd there is no easement for a trail through that property. <br />He then indicated he was not sure why the C-I zoning was put in place but noted that <br />way back the City realized that there were already established homes on the property and <br />the City would need to condemn land or purchase easements in order to have the trail. <br /> <br />Commissioner Kilian commented that he did not think it made sense to have a trail <br />branch offfrom the main trails to travel through residents' backyards because the trail <br />does not go anywhere. <br /> <br />Commissioner Helmbrecht commented that there would be no lighting. <br /> <br />Commissioner Wilharber commented that he has always maintained there is a safety <br />issue with children with a trail next to a creek. <br /> <br />Page 4 of? <br />
